In addition to writing the book "A Plum In The Syrup", I've also developed and have patented The Easy Reader Publishing Model. This book is the first in literary history to be published using the Easy Reader model. This publishing model was developed to help you boost your reading speed by as much as 100% or more when reading books and documents on a computer screen or digital reader. People are looking for a better, more efficient way to absorb information and this model will help them do just that. Reading books and documents when rendered on a computer monitor presents a unique set of challenges. Namely, skim reading is a method used by many to get through an electronic document more quickly. The Easy Reader publishing model will assist with skim reading. Here are the two rules to keep in mind to get the most from the Easy Reader publishing model: 1) Every other line of a paragraph is rendered backwards. The words themselves in backwards lines are right reading but the line itself is backwards. (Confused? Don't be you'll soon see for yourself how easy it is to read a backwards sentence.) Rendering the book's text in this way will enable you to read in a zigzag pattern rather than dragging your eyes back across the page. Reading this way will boost your reading speed considerably with no loss of reading comprehension. 2) The first line of every paragraph is rendered right reading, left to right, regardless of how the last line in the previous paragraph was rendered.
